不懂就问:空格为什么有两种?(卡了我一天的 bug 竟然是空格导致的)

2020-04-24 15:57:00 +08:00
 wasd6267016

肉眼看上去一样同样两个配置,一个生效,一个不生效

十分不解,最后偶然发现是两个配置的空格不一样

常见的空格转 base64 是 IA== 这个空格转 base64 是 wqA=

在 excel 里看这两者没什么区别……

求解

1693 次点击
所在节点    问与答
11 条回复
wasd6267016
2020-04-24 15:57:37 +08:00
Jat001
2020-04-24 16:04:01 +08:00
全角吧
cnmllll
2020-04-24 16:04:02 +08:00
你是不是遇到了 No-Break Space
wangkun025
2020-04-24 16:08:09 +08:00
Excel……
also24
2020-04-24 16:09:03 +08:00
wasd6267016
2020-04-24 16:40:22 +08:00
@wangkun025 嗯 因为配置是在 excel 里策划配的
wasd6267016
2020-04-24 16:40:53 +08:00
@Jat001 可能
wasd6267016
2020-04-24 16:41:10 +08:00
@also24 我晕了 你的狗头怎么打的
wasd6267016
2020-04-24 16:42:41 +08:00
@Jat001 试了貌似不是 我开搜狗输入法的全角 打了个空格  转 base64 是 44CA
Acoffice
2020-04-24 16:45:23 +08:00
wasd6267016
2020-04-24 16:45:51 +08:00
@cnmllll 破案了 转成 ascii 看了 是\u00A0 (non-breaking space)

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/665713

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X